When you think of Hakodate, one comes to mind the mountain Hakodate, known for its million dollar night vision. Viewed from Hakodate-Yama Mountain at night, the lights of the city lie in the dark velvet of the bay like a thousand embroidered beads. The Michelin Green Guide Japan rated Hakodate's breathtaking interplay of urban atmosphere and embedding in the harsh nature of the north as outstanding as the night vision of Hong Kong or Naples.
The ascent to the 334-meter-high mountain is made possible by the comfortable cab lift from the city center in just three minutes or on foot in about 30 minutes.
